SEN HLTA (Higher Level Teaching Assistant)
Location: Sidcup
Salary: Competitive, based on experience

Are you passionate about supporting children with Special Educational Needs? Academics is seeking a dedicated and enthusiastic SEN HLTA to join a supportive school in Sidcup. This is a fantastic opportunity for someone who wants to make a real difference in the lives of children with diverse learning needs.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Support the class teacher in delivering high-quality education to children with special educational needs.
  • Assist in planning and implementing personalised learning plans for students.
  • Provide support in small group and one-on-one settings, adapting activities to meet individual needs.
  • Monitor and assess student progress, providing constructive feedback to students and teachers.
  • Foster a positive and inclusive learning environment, promoting independence and confidence among students.
  • Collaborate with other staff members, parents, and external specialists to ensure the best outcomes for students.

Requirements:

  • Relevant qualifications (e.g., Level 4 Teaching Assistant qualification or equivalent) or experience as an SEN HLTA.
  • Experience working with children with special educational needs, preferably in a school setting.
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to build rapport with students and staff.
  • A proactive and compassionate approach to supporting learning.
  • Knowledge of various SEN strategies and interventions is desirable.
